Here's how you can effectively handle negative or critical feedback.
Receiving negative or critical feedback can be a tough pill to swallow, but it's a valuable opportunity for personal and professional growth. Your analytical skills can be your best ally in this process, helping you dissect the feedback and use it constructively. Whether it's in a work setting or personal life, the ability to handle criticism with grace and poise can set you apart and lead to significant improvements in your performance and relationships. By approaching feedback analytically, you can separate emotion from fact, identify actionable insights, and create a plan for development that leverages the critique you've received.
